This document reports on the first high-quality draft genome sequence of Pasteurella multocida sequence type 128 isolated from the infected bone of a woman bitten by a dog. The genome was sequenced and assembled into 23 contigs totaling 2.3 megabases. Annotation identified over 2,000 protein-coding genes, 10 rRNAs, and 50 tRNAs. Comparison to other P. multocida genomes confirmed the identification as P. multocida and determined it was sequence type 128, which has only been reported once before from a sheep in New Zealand. The genome provides new genomic resources that can improve understanding of P. multocida pathogenesis.
